Output 25e7361484fb50a0653d4684dd293aab1c942341cc7e19647c3096f8bf753fb8:2

value
656884
script pubkey
OP_0 OP_PUSHBYTES_20 00cf9450f94e5c352776c08809ad595a0c959623
address
tb1qqr8eg58efewr2fmkczyqnt2etgxft93rc6lwee
transaction
25e7361484fb50a0653d4684dd293aab1c942341cc7e19647c3096f8bf753fb8
confirmations
80692
spent
true